In this brochure, ForteBio outlines its Sialic Acid Kit. The GlyS kit is designed to enable the use of crude cell culture samples without any purification or digestion, screen for samples with desired sialylation levels and combine titer data with sialic acid data for more informed decisions.

The Octet® GlyM Kit enables high-throughput mannose content screening in crude cell culture samples during early clone selection stages in the CLD process. When combined with titer analysis, it expedites the selection of the top performing cell lines producing proteins with the most favorable glycan (mannose) profile. funnel through samples that are high producers and have desirable sialic acid content.
